As Finance Analyst you will be supporting the Finance Leads by delivering financial analysis and insight for Networks and IT Opex, including IFRS processing. You will be supporting on forecasting, month-end processes, financial reporting and business partnering.
You will be responsible for providing financial insight, control and support to a variety of teams business wide to support the short and long term financial plans. You will use your commercial skills to highlight opportunities for further efficiencies to ensure the opex is run in a cost-effective manner.
You will be an integral part of driving the transformation of the post-merger forecasting, budget and reporting to ensure effective business information and governance processes are in place, to ensure the business are informed, but also own and are held to account for delivery of financial targets.
The role requires a strong commercial mindset, a good understanding of the areas you support, strong stakeholder management, relationship building skills with the ability and confidence to challenge the status quo, and drive performance and results.
- Own the month end reporting processes and initial preparation of reporting packs
- Leading on financial analysis, month end variance analysis, consolidation of results feeding into Finance Leads and communicating out to the business. This role will use strong understanding of the business and relevant areas to drive analysis and deliver insights
- This role will utilize analytical skills, business partnering and presentational skills, whilst leading on specific topics during budget and quarterly re-forecasts to ensure accurate reporting and understanding of business performance.
